What are square feet and hectares?
A square foot is a square 12 inches on each side (about 0.0929 m²), standard for US floor area. A hectare is 10,000 square meters (about 2.47 acres), the metric unit for land area. For scale: a tennis court is about 261 m² (2,808 ft²), and a soccer pitch is roughly 0.7 hectares.
How to convert square feet to hectares
1 ft² = 0.0000092903 ha. To convert, multiply the number of square feet by 0.0000092903. For example, 5 ft² = 0.0000464515 ha, and 20 ft² = 0.000185806 ha. To go the other way, multiply hectares by 107,639 (since 1 ha = 107,639 ft²).
